Printing on Specialty Media Printing on Specialty Media This section includes: ■ Printing Transparencies on page 3-28 ■ Printing Envelopes on page 3-34 ■ Printing Labels on page 3-40 ■ Printing Glossy Paper on page 3-46 ■ Printing Custom Size Paper on page 3-52 Printing Transparencies Transparencies can be printed from any tray. They should be printed on one side only. Use only recommended Xerox transparency film. See the Recommended Media List at www.xerox.com/office/8500_8550support. Caution: Damage caused by using unsupported paper, transparencies, and other specialty media is not covered by the Xerox warranty, service agreement, or Total Satisfaction Guarantee. Guidelines ■ Remove all paper before loading transparencies in the tray. ■ Handle transparencies by the edges using both hands. Fingerprints or creases can cause poor print quality. ■ Do not load more than 50 transparencies in Tray 1. Do not load more than 400 transparencies in Trays 2 through 4. Overloading the tray can cause the printer to jam. ■ Do not use transparencies with stripes on the side. ■ After loading transparencies, change the paper type at the control panel (Printer Setup/ Paper Handling Setup).
